Enter Herschel Supply Co. bags. Founded in 2009 by brothers Jamie and Lyndon Cormack, Herschel adopted the name of the small town where 3 generations of their family were raised. The company, whose goal is to create timeless products with fine regard for detail, is based in Vancouver, Canada.

And timeless products they are. Just check out some of my favorites out of their Fall 2015 collection. They’re all stylish yet very practical. I can already see myself bringing these backpacks during my upcoming trips abroad.

Materials used for the bags include cotton canvas, lustrous nylon and reflective fabric. The collection highlights elegant backpack silhouettes plus functional tote bags. According to Herschel, prints this season include “the whimsical Feather and wildflower Ruby, luscious Windsor Wine and dramatic Deep Ultra Marine, drawing from the eternal blue of an ocean dream.” That almost sounded poetic, yes?
